Dental Sedation Dryden

Some patients may feel anxious or uncomfortable when visiting the dentist. At Sunset Country Dental in Dryden, dental care can be provided under nitrous oxide (laughing gas) to help patients feel more at ease during treatment.

Sedation dentistry can be considered for individuals who experience:

  • Dental fear or anxiety
  • A strong gag reflex
  • Sensitivity to dental treatment or a low pain threshold
  • The need for longer or multiple procedures in a limited timeframe
  • Difficulty cooperating during dental procedures, including some children and patients with special needs

All forms of sedation are provided under the supervision of a qualified dentist, following appropriate safety protocols and monitoring requirements.

Nitrous Oxide Sedation

Nitrous oxide, commonly known as "laughing gas" is a type of conscious sedation used in dentistry to help reduce anxiety and promote relaxation during dental treatment. It is inhaled through a small mask placed over the nose, and its effects begin within minutes.

Characteristics and Considerations:
  • The level of sedation can be adjusted easily during the procedure.
  • The effects wear off quickly once the gas is stopped and oxygen is administered.
  • Patients remain awake, responsive, and able to breathe normally throughout treatment.
  • In most cases, patients can resume normal activities after the appointment.

Nitrous oxide has been used safely for many years in both dental and medical settings. As with any medical procedure, there are some situations in which nitrous oxide may not be appropriate. It may not be recommended for patients with certain respiratory conditions, such as ch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), emphysema, or other significant breathing difficulties, or for individuals with severe claustrophobia.

Your dentist will review your medical history and assess whether this form of sedation is suitable for you. A brief trial of nitrous oxide may also be offered to determine comfort and tolerance before proceeding with treatment.
